Q: How old do you have to be to get a tattoo?
A: At least, 17 years old. ANYONE getting a tattoo MUST have a state issued photo ID or drivers license. If under 18, you must be accompanied by a parent who also has a state ID or drivers license AND your birth certificate.
Q: How old do you have to be to get a body piercing?
A: Not all piercings are suitable for all ages and the minimum age varies depending on the piercing, please call for more details. If you are under 18 years old, state law requires that a parent be present. For us to verify that you are the child of the parent you must bring: Photo ID for the parent, birth certificate of the child, plus a school ID, photo ID, drivers license, or school yearbook for the child. Plus, if the last name is different, we must have proof as to why, ie: certificate of marriage. Please call for more information.

Q: Do you have/use an autoclave?
A: YES We have an autoclave and we clean it regularly in addition to weekly testing by North Bay Bioscience, To ensure that it is working properly.
Q: Do you ever reuse needles?
A: NO We use brand new, sterilized needles for each customer and will show them to you when setting up for your procedure. After we use them they are disposed of immediately into a Sharps container.
